Protective effects of the extract from longan flower against hepatic ischemia/reperfusion injury in rats

• Longan flower ethyl acetate extract (LFEE) exhibits protective effects on hepatic ischemia/reperfusion injury in rat model.
• Upon hepatic ischemia/reperfusion, LFEE can further enhance anti-oxidation activity of rats.
• LFEE significantly decreases inflammation of the liver induced by hepatic ischemia/reperfusion.
• The supplement of LFEE before hepatotomy or liver transplantation can prevent the patients form liver injury.

Ischemia/reperfusion (I/R) injury has a complex pathophysiology resulting from a number of contributing factors. The effect of longan flower ethyl acetate extract (LFEE) on hepatic I/R injury in rats was examined. Aspartate aminotransferase, alanine aminotransferase, hepatic thiobarbituric acid reactive substances (TBARS), interleukin-1β, interleukin-6, interleukin-10, tumor necrosis factor-α, inducible nitric oxide synthase, and cyclooxygenase-2 activities were significantly increased after I/R injury, but decreased in the groups with LFEE treatment. Significant decrease in hepatic glutathione levels after I/R injury was observed upon LFEE treatment. NADPH:quinone oxidoreductase 1 activity was significantly increased after I/R injury, and it was further increased in the groups with LFEE treatment. Histological results indicated that LFEE was effective in improving liver tissue morphology during I/R injury. Therefore, LFEE might offer a novel intervention for patients suffering from I/R of the liver especially in the process of hepatotomy and liver transplantation.
